Huawei: Adjust Long-Press Duration on the Keyboard

If holding down a key on your Huawei keyboard inserts alternate symbols too fast or too slow, the long-press duration on SwiftKey Keyboard is not tuned to your typing speed. This delay controls exactly when a background character, like an accent mark or number, appears after you press and hold a key. The default sits at 450ms, but you can move it anywhere between 100ms and 1600ms.

Set Long-Press Duration for the Keyboard auf Huawei

Every key on the SwiftKey Keyboard carries a hidden symbol or number that only appears when you press and hold. How long that press has to last before the symbol shows up is controlled by the long-press duration, which defaults to 450ms on Huawei phones running EMUI.

If you type fast, that delay can feel sluggish and cause you to trigger the alternate symbol by accident while trying to hit a normal letter. If you type slowly or have limited finger mobility, the same delay might feel too short, popping up numbers or accents when you only meant to tap once.

You find the setting under Open the settingsTap on System & updatesTap on Language & inputTap on SwiftKey KeyboardTap on TypingTap on Keys. From there, Pull the bar to the left or right to set the Long-press duration, choosing anywhere from 100ms up to 1600ms.

A shorter value reacts faster to a held key but raises the risk of accidental symbol input. A longer value protects against mistakes but makes the alternate symbols feel slower to access. There is no universal correct number, only the value that matches how deliberately you press keys.
